Artificial Intelligence Designed 3D-printed Solid-state Li Metal Batteries. This project targets challenges in solid-state Li metal batteries (SSLMBs), lithium dendrite growth and poor interfacial contact, with cutting-edge 3D printing and Artificial Intelligence (AI) techniques. Leveraging AI’s predictive capabilities on extensive databases, optimal materials and structures for SSLMBs will be identified. The designed SSLMBs will be precisely fabricated with 3D printing techniques. Expected outcomes include novel solid-state electrolyte formulations, smart battery structures, and high-performance SSLMBs. The project will benefit Australia’s energy storage innovation and economic growth, bolstering Australia’s global leadership in advanced energy technologies.. Scheme: Discovery Projects.
